Article Summary
Russian ballistic missiles struck Kyiv, killing at least nine people and injuring dozens, including children, while damaging homes, a school, and the Lithuanian embassy. Residents had barely any time to reach shelters, and survivors described chaos and destruction. The article emphasizes the human toll and calls for stronger international support for Ukraine, especially in providing air defense systems.
